The Dillon Invitational Coach Pitch tournament was held on Saturday, May 24, with Herald Office Systems claiming the championship title.

City of Dillon Recreation Director Kevin Scott managed the 17-game double elimination tournament, which included teams from Dillon, Latta, and Lake View.

In the first rounds, GBI, Inc., defeated Family Sports; Latta defeated the Sheriff’s Posse; Herald Office Systems defeated Lake View Towing; and Dillon Internal Medicine defeated Dillon Electric. Latta earned a win over B&C Steak and Bar-b-que, and Family Sports defeated the Sheriff’s Posse with Lake View Towing defeating Dillon Electric.

Herald Office defeated Dillon Internal Medicine to advance, and the Sheriff’s Posse defeated Family Sports. Lake View Towing eliminated B&C; Latta defeated GBI; and Lake View Towing defeated GBI.

Latta handed Herald Office their first loss of the season, 11-9, but Herald Office defeated Lake View Towing and Latta defeated Dillon Internal to send both teams to the championship game.

Herald Office defeated Latta in the first championship game, forcing a second where HOS earned the championship title.
